Output 64c7383e6acb5e40d195fb9dd16b0c04de97ffdda76dfb4d13cf4ad1c0295c26:1

value
1123224
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f62c5bd9d3c191d21b50bd9d59ed23815a4f1e64 OP_EQUAL
address
3Q8fHqVqVXNiA7bymiUUxjuksfSvPNuz22
transaction
64c7383e6acb5e40d195fb9dd16b0c04de97ffdda76dfb4d13cf4ad1c0295c26
spent
true